SENATE RESOLUTION
2
WHEREAS, The members of the Illinois Senate are saddened
3
to learn of the death of Celeste Cavalier Banks Sawyer Taylor,
4
who passed away on May 10, 2026; and
5
WHEREAS, Celeste Taylor was born to Willie Winslow Banks
6
and Henrietta Odalie Bryant Banks in New Orleans, Louisiana on
7
September 3, 1935; while residing in New Orleans, she attended
8
Berean Center Kindergarten, McDonogh #36 Elementary School,
9
Valena C. Jones Elementary School, Gilbert Academy, and
10
McDonogh #35 Senior High School; and
11
WHEREAS, Celeste Taylor proceeded to attend Alabama State
12
University in Montgomery and DePaul University in Chicago;
13
during her studies, she became a member of Alpha Kappa Alpha
14
Sorority, Incorporated in 1954; and
15
WHEREAS, Celeste Taylor married Eugene Sawyer Jr., and
16
they had three children; she later married Roosevelt Taylor
17
Jr., and she became a stepmother and step-grandmother; and
18
WHEREAS, Celeste Taylor committed to her faith at an early
19
age, being first baptized as an infant at First Street
20
Methodist Church in New Orleans; upon her request as a young
21
adult, she received her second baptism, again at First Street
SR0852
- 2 -
LRB104 21996 LAW 38010 r
1
Methodist Church; in Illinois, she obtained her third baptism
2
by immersion at Wesley United Methodist Church in Harvey in
3
1983; and
4
WHEREAS, Celeste Taylor was preceded in death by her
5
sister, Adelaide "A.J."; her first husband; her second
6
husband; and her infant granddaughter, Shannon Eugene Sawyer;
7
and
8
WHEREAS, Celeste Taylor is survived by her children,
9
Shedrick Eugene, Sheryl Celeste, and Roderick Terrence; her
10
children-in-law, Winston B. McGill Jr. and Cheryll Denise
11
Aikens; her grandchildren, Jessica Celeste Sawyer, Alexandria
12
Roswita Sawyer, Sydni Celeste Sawyer, and Roderick Terrence
13
"Sonny" Sawyer Jr.; her great-granddaughter, Mason Rose
14
Robinson; her stepchildren, Roseylyne, Rhoda, and Rachel; her
15
step-grandchildren; her siblings; her nieces, nephews, and
16
cousins; her St. Mark A.M.E. Zion Church family; and her
17
friends and neighbors; therefore, be it
18
RESOLVED, BY THE SENATE OF THE ONE HUNDRED FOURTH GENERAL
19
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F ILLINOIS, that we mourn the passing of
20
Celeste Cavalier Banks Sawyer Taylor and extend our sincere
21
condolences to her family, friends, and all who knew and loved
22
her; and be it further
SR0852
- 3 -
LRB104 21996 LAW 38010 r
1
RESOLVED, That a suitable copy of this resolution be
2
presented to the family of Celeste Taylor as an expression of
3
our deepest sympathy.
